Type
ORACLE
Validation date
2024-11-23 18:01:40 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02099,
    "usd": 0.02187
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00010828CA927B26F176268F23B0C3257CEE873A8BE4A3A9BA5B0D1552691711B53B

Previous signature

C308D8BA2BE0BAC016C39D7C49A5275D2E679025AD048BBE99DCEFD938761217E073E0D1EBC94E187656137A5385F08A6B61B4874991AD2A5D1A2DD9B93C9F00

Origin signature

3046022100B1FFB981FD1E2889D9768DF14538B509A8F49D9642933FC5BC56DD9BB62C9379022100E85D12DE1ABAD4C39CAC94C6055588A544B90AAD928A89D7BC4AACE560BDF19A

Proof of work

010104641D2D652B2A36CDE32EABB7AC1D6F0351A1CFAE45BA1483ADAD99B166DB289E9E408C13C28D10F62F068EE552C651FAA5A2BD6417D68EAFC8C269FBD2FBE9E3

Proof of integrity

00A74CCFDFC84A1E547B53FDE40145C93E4EDB5F257CFFACCA152ACA203EFC8EDF

Coordinator signature

472BB6A17B44C4D5999C02215913EED4DB8E674009A34D20BFB1558838F8106EA21B43F43993DD82D04396007839012278DDF493B692C49BCF90CD483794430E

Validator #1 public key

00010F74B5FEB03F130C26B66BB24AA5066168510220DC9D6C2590294863AC9C8DEE

Validator #1 signature

705E56530C3CA8AC2BE6F62D9336840BAAAB3F9C44E65F0769A48E25F26DBBD6297EA4372BD0394DB211855875297C46EA839177D47CD24A614B27499A057402

Validator #2 public key

00019721EC9787441F168794A0FB579F9383EE194BC5C71D8AA97B1ED6B1B95826F4

Validator #2 signature

D317510EDFE3902F95BE317DCDD5A5F861202FC795F1092D8C7F49F654C1DB3DD445EF79AD4A1FE9E58845384DD4535DC4DAE71D88E4540D466170BBB3C37B00